CRecordset::IsDeleted
Determina se o registro atual foi excluído.
Sintaxe
BOOL IsDeleted( ) const;
Valor de retorno
Diferente de zero se o conjunto de registros é posicionado em um registro excluído; se não 0.
Comentários
Se você colocar um registro e IsDeleted retorna Verdadeiro (diferente de zero), então você deve rolar outro registro antes de executar todas as outras operações de conjunto de registros.
O resultado de IsDeleted depende de vários fatores, como o tipo do conjunto de registros, se seu conjunto de registros é atualizável, se você especificou a opção de CRecordset::skipDeletedRecords quando você abriu o conjunto de registros, se seus registros excluídos blocos de driver, e se há vários usuários.
Para obter mais informações sobre CRecordset::skipDeletedRecords e de uso de driver, consulte a função de membro de Abrir .
Dica
Se você tiver implementado a linha em massa que pesquisa, você não deve chamar IsDeleted.Em vez de isso, chame a função de membro de GetRowStatus .Para obter mais informações sobre a linha em massa que pesquisa, consulte o artigo conjunto de registros: Para buscar registros em massa (ODBC).
Requisitos
Cabeçalho: afxdb.h
Consulte também
Classe de CRecordset
Gráfico da hierarquia
CRecordset::Delete
CRecordset::IsBOF
CRecordset::IsEOF
CRecordset::Move